gtemata.com

Cum se instalează SDK-ul Qt pe Ubuntu

Kitul de dezvoltare software Qt (SDK)

un cadru de aplicații inter-platformă folosit în mod obișnuit pentru a dezvolta aplicații software cu o interfață grafică (GUI). Unele dintre cele mai cunoscute aplicații dezvoltate cu Qt sunt KDE, operă, Google Earth și Skype. Este un cadru portabil aplicație multi-platformă pentru interfețe de utilizator care rulează pe sistemele de operare Windows, Linux și Mac OS X. Qt SDK vă ajută să creați interfețe grafice pentru aplicațiile dvs. care pot rula pe Windows, Linux și Mac OS X. Pentru informații mai detaliate, vizitați Site-ul Qt SDK. Pentru mai multe informații despre cum să creați primul program Qt, puteți găsi articole care discută subiectul pe wikiHow.

Notă: Acest document acoperă instalarea versiunii pe 64 de biți a Qt SDK 4.8 Qt SDK 5.0, pe Ubuntu Linux și poate fi urmat și pentru sisteme Debian și Linux Mint.

paşi

Metoda 1

Instrucțiuni de instalare pentru SDK Qt 4.8
1
În primul rând determină arhitectura (32 de biți sau 64 de biți) de versiunea de Ubuntu, prin deschiderea unui terminal și tastați următoarele comenzi, apoi descărca versiunea Qt SDK-ul pentru sistemul de operare. De exemplu, dacă utilizați Ubuntu Linux pe 32 de biți, descărcați SDK-ul QT pe 32 de biți.
  • Tip / Copy / Paste: fișier / sbin / init
  • Rețineți versiunea sistemului dvs. de operare, fie că este vorba de 32 sau 64 de biți.
  • 2
  • Selectați arhitectura sistemului dvs. Ubuntu pentru a descărca versiunea corectă a setului SDK. De asemenea, puteți descărca bibliotecile de dezvoltare, astfel încât să puteți rula aplicațiile Qt fără complicații, urmând pașii de mai jos.
  • Notă: pentru a descărca SDK, descărcați programul de instalare offline, deoarece altfel instalarea va dura mult timp dacă nu aveți o conexiune foarte rapidă.
  • Aveți două opțiuni pentru a descărca setul de instrumente Qt SDK, programul de instalare online și offline. După cum sa menționat mai devreme, descărcarea durează mult timp, deci este posibil să fie util să descărcați programul de instalare offline, care conține deja toate datele necesare.
  • 3
    Deschideți un terminal și introduceți următoarea comandă:
  • Tip / Copy / Paste: sudo apt-get instalați synaptic
  • Tip / Copy / Paste: sudo apt-get update
  • Această comandă este utilizată pentru actualizarea și resincronizarea fișierelor cu index de pachete de la sursă prin intermediul internetului.
  • Tip / Copy / Paste: sudo apt-get instalare qt4-dev-tools libqt4-dev libqt4-core libqt4-gui
  • Această comandă adaugă bibliotecile de dezvoltare Qt sistemului dvs. Ubuntu, permițând programelor să ruleze fără probleme în sistemul dvs.
  • Tip / Copy / Paste: cd / home /"your_user_name"/ Descărcări
  • Veți ajunge la dosarul Descărcări al sistemului.
  • 4
    Tip / Copy / Paste: sudo -s chmod u + x QtSdk-offline-linux-x86_64-v1.2.1.run
  • Această comandă face SDK-ul Qt executabil pentru toți utilizatorii sistemului.
  • 5
    Instalați setul SDK Qt cu următoarea comandă:
  • Tip / Copy / Paste: sudo -s ./QtSdk-offline-linux-x86_64-v1.2.1.run -style cleanlooks
  • Veți avea nevoie de privilegii de superuser pentru a instala SDK-ul.
  • 6
    Când instalați kitul Qt SDK vi se va solicita să alegeți un folder unde să salvați fișierele de programe. Scrieți / optați și SDK va fi instalat într-un director numit / opt / QtSDK
  • 7
    Modificați permisiunile pentru a face disponibil dosarul Qt SDK pentru toți utilizatorii cu următoarea comandă:
  • 8
    Tip / Copy / Paste: sudo-s chmod-R 777 / opt / QtSDK
  • Această comandă face SDK-ul Qt executabil pentru toți utilizatorii sistemului.
  • 9
    Tip / Copy / Paste: sudo -s chmod -R 777 / home /"your_user_name"/.config/rokia
  • Această comandă va evita mesajele de eroare când porniți QtCreator, ceea ce indică faptul că nu puteți scrie în directorul / home /"your_user_name"/.config/rokia.
  • 10
    Instalați programul Qt, deschideți terminalul și utilizați un editor de text ca Nano sau Gedit pentru a edita / etc / profile.
  • Tip / Copy / Paste: sudo -s nano / etc / profil
  • sau
  • Tip / Copy / Paste: sudo -s gedit / etc / profil
  • 11
    Derulați până la sfârșitul fișierului / etc / profile și introduceți următorul text. Ar trebui să adăugați această linie la sfârșitul fișierului pentru a avea capacitatea de a compila programele Qt direct din linia de comandă.
  • 12
    Tip / Copy / Paste:
  • PATH = / opt / QtSDK / Spațiul de lucru / Qt /4.8.1/ Gcc / bin: $ PATH
  • export PATH
  • 13
    Numărul indicat cu caractere aldine din comanda anterioară reprezintă versiunea SDK Qt, deci asigurați-vă că ați introdus numărul corect pentru versiunea dvs. SDK-ul Qt este îmbunătățit în mod constant cu noi actualizări. Asigurați-vă că acordați atenție numărului versiunii.
  • În acest exemplu, folosim versiunea 4.8.1 a Qt și vom folosi acest număr în rândul pe care îl vom adăuga în fișierul / etc / profile.
  • 14
    Salvați fișierul / etc / profile și ieșiți.
  • 15
    Reîncărcați fișierul / etc / profile cu următoarea comandă.
  • Tip / Copy / Paste: . / Etc / profil
  • Asigurați-vă că introduceți a "." și apoi un spațiu pentru a reîncărca fișierul.
  • 16
    După reîncărcarea fișierului / etc / profile, tastați următoarea comandă pentru a vă asigura că Ubuntu a introdus SDK-ul Qt în sistemul PATH.
  • 17
    Tip / Copy / Paste: care qmake
  • Răspunsul ar trebui să fie unul dintre următoarele.
  • /opt/QtSDK/Desktop/Qt/4.8.1/gcc/bin/qmake
  • 18
    De asemenea, tastați următoarea comandă:
  • Tip / Copy / Paste: qmake -versiune
  • 19
    Ar trebui să primiți un răspuns în felul următor:
  • `QMake versiunea 2.01a
  • `Utilizând versiunea Qt 4.8.1 în /opt/QtSDK/Desktop/Qt/4.8.1/gcc/lib
  • 20
    Aceste răspunsuri vă informează că aveți capacitatea de a compila programele Qt din linia de comandă. Acum aveți tot ce aveți nevoie pentru a compila programele Qt pe sistemul dvs. Ubuntu. După instalarea cu succes a kitului Qt SDK, dacă doriți să încercați să creați un program, puteți găsi articole care vă arată cum să faceți acest lucru pe wikiHow.
  • Metoda 2

    Instrucțiuni de instalare pentru SDK Qt 5.0

    1
    În primul rând determină arhitectura (32 de biți sau 64 de biți) de versiunea de Ubuntu, prin deschiderea unui terminal și tastați următoarele comenzi, apoi descărca versiunea Qt SDK-ul pentru sistemul de operare. De exemplu, dacă utilizați Ubuntu Linux pe 32 de biți, descărcați SDK-ul QT pe 32 de biți.
    • Tip / Copy / Paste: fișier / sbin / init
    • Rețineți versiunea sistemului dvs. de operare, fie că este vorba de 32 sau 64 de biți.
  • 2
  • Selectați arhitectura sistemului dvs. Ubuntu pentru a descărca versiunea corectă a setului SDK. De asemenea, puteți descărca bibliotecile de dezvoltare, astfel încât să puteți rula aplicațiile Qt fără complicații, urmând pașii de mai jos.
  • Notă: pentru a descărca SDK, descărcați programul de instalare offline, deoarece altfel instalarea va dura mult timp dacă nu aveți o conexiune foarte rapidă.
  • Aveți două opțiuni pentru a descărca setul de instrumente Qt SDK, programul de instalare online și offline. După cum sa menționat mai devreme, descărcarea durează mult timp, deci este posibil să fie util să descărcați programul de instalare offline, care conține deja toate datele necesare.
  • 3
    Deschideți un terminal și introduceți următoarea comandă:
  • Tip / Copy / Paste: sudo apt-get instalați synaptic
  • Tip / Copy / Paste: sudo apt-get update
  • Această comandă este utilizată pentru actualizarea și resincronizarea fișierelor cu index de pachete de la sursă prin intermediul internetului.
  • Tip / Copy / Paste: sudo apt-get instalare qt4-dev-tools libqt4-dev libqt4-core libqt4-gui
  • Această comandă adaugă bibliotecile de dezvoltare Qt sistemului dvs. Ubuntu, permițând programelor să ruleze fără probleme în sistemul dvs. Această informație a fost introdusă în cazul în care am vrut să instalez bibliotecile compatibile cu versiunea 4.8 a SDK.
  • Tip / Copy / Paste: sudo apt-get instalează build-essential
  • Această comandă va adăuga biblioteci suplimentare C C ++ pentru compilare.
  • Tip / Copy / Paste: sudo apt-get install "Libxcb ^. *" libx11-xcb-dev libglu1-mesa-dev libxrender-dev
  • Această comandă adaugă funcționalitatea OpenGL la executarea aplicațiilor Qt.
  • Tip / Copy / Paste: cd / home /"your_user_name"/ Descărcări
  • Veți ajunge la dosarul Descărcări al sistemului.
  • 4
    Tip / Copy / Paste: sudo -s chmod u + x qt-linux-opensource-5.0.2-x86_64-offline.run
  • Această comandă face SDK-ul Qt executabil pentru toți utilizatorii sistemului.
  • 5
    Instalați setul SDK Qt cu următoarea comandă:
  • Tip / Copy / Paste: sudo -s ./qt-linux-opensource-5.0.2-x86_64-offline.run -style cleanlooks
  • Veți avea nevoie de privilegii de superuser pentru a instala SDK-ul.
  • 6
    Când instalați kitul Qt SDK vi se va solicita să alegeți un folder unde să salvați fișierele de programe. Scrieți / optați și SDK va fi instalat într-un director numit / opt / QtSDK
  • 7
    Modificați permisiunile pentru a face disponibil dosarul Qt SDK pentru toți utilizatorii cu următoarea comandă:
  • 8
    Tip / Copy / Paste: sudo-s chmod -R 777 /opt/Qt5.0.2
  • Această comandă face SDK-ul Qt executabil pentru toți utilizatorii sistemului.
  • 9
    Tip / Copy / Paste: sudo -s chmod -R 777 / home /"your_user_name"/.config/QtProject
  • Această comandă va evita mesajele de eroare când porniți QtCreator, ceea ce indică faptul că nu puteți scrie în directorul / home /"your_user_name"/.config/QtProject.
  • 10
    Instalați programul Qt, deschideți terminalul și utilizați un editor de text ca Nano sau Gedit pentru a edita / etc / profile.
  • Tip / Copy / Paste: sudo -s nano / etc / profil
  • sau
  • Tip / Copy / Paste: sudo -s gedit / etc / profil
  • 11
    Derulați până la sfârșitul fișierului / etc / profile și introduceți următorul text. Ar trebui să adăugați această linie la sfârșitul fișierului pentru a avea capacitatea de a compila programele Qt direct din linia de comandă.
  • 12
    Tip / Copy / Paste:
  • PATH = / opt /Qt5.0.2 / 5.0.2 /GCC / bin: $ PATH
  • export PATH
  • 13
    Numărul indicat cu caractere aldine din comanda anterioară reprezintă versiunea SDK Qt, deci asigurați-vă că ați introdus numărul corect pentru versiunea dvs. SDK-ul Qt este îmbunătățit în mod constant cu noi actualizări. Asigurați-vă că acordați atenție numărului versiunii.
  • În acest exemplu, folosim Qt versiunea 5.0.2 și vom folosi acest număr în linia pe care o vom adăuga în fișierul / etc / profile.
  • 14
    Salvați fișierul / etc / profile și ieșiți.
  • 15
    Reîncărcați fișierul / etc / profile cu următoarea comandă.
  • Tip / Copy / Paste: . / Etc / profil
  • Asigurați-vă că introduceți a "." și apoi un spațiu pentru a reîncărca fișierul.
  • 16
    După reîncărcarea fișierului / etc / profile, tastați următoarea comandă pentru a vă asigura că Ubuntu a introdus SDK-ul Qt în sistemul PATH.
  • 17
    Tip / Copy / Paste: care qmake
  • Răspunsul ar trebui să fie unul dintre următoarele.
  • /opt/Qt5.0.2/5.0.2/gcc/bin/qmake
  • 18
    De asemenea, tastați următoarea comandă:
  • Tip / Copy / Paste: qmake -versiune
  • 19
    Ar trebui să primiți un răspuns în felul următor:
  • QMake versiunea 3.0
  • Folosind versiunea Qt 5.0.2 în /opt/Qt5.0.2/5.0.2/gcc/lib
  • 20
    Aceste răspunsuri vă informează că aveți capacitatea de a compila programele Qt din linia de comandă. Acum aveți tot ce aveți nevoie pentru a compila programele Qt pe sistemul dvs. Ubuntu. După instalarea cu succes a kitului Qt SDK, dacă doriți să încercați să creați un program, puteți găsi articole care vă arată cum să faceți acest lucru pe wikiHow.
  • Distribuiți pe rețelele sociale:

    înrudit